Epitacio Delacruz San Antonio, Texas

Address: 179 Price Ave, San Antonio 78211, TX

Age: 82

Phone: (210) 927-7198

168 Price Ave, San Antonio, TX 78211
3319 La Violeta St, San Antonio, TX 78211

Epitacio Delacruz Epitacio T Delacruz Epitacio E Delacruz Cruz Epitacio

Epitacio Delacruz Oklahoma City, Oklahoma

Address: 741 SE 12th St, Oklahoma City 73129, OK

Phone: (405) 634-7430

